There’s a familiar face arriving on CBS’ “Dallas” Friday at 10 p.m. for a five-episode stint--Barbara Eden.

When a “Dallas” producer called Eden and asked her to guest star, it meant a reunion with her “I Dream of Jeannie” co-star Larry (J.R. Ewing) Hagman. But don’t expect Eden to expose her navel, say “Yes, master” or blink in and out of the Ewing Ranch.

“I play a former Texan, Lee Ann De La Vega, who is an oil heiress,” Eden said. “She had a wonderful marriage and her husband died and left her with all of these billions and billions of dollars. Isn’t that wonderful? She is brilliant, of course, and a brilliant business woman.”

And she’s bad. “Well,” said Eden with a laugh, “not exactly bad. She is just smart. J.R. knew her when they were in college, but he doesn’t remember her. She comes back (to Dallas) because she meets someone who J.R. had wronged and she remembers what a rascal he was and is and decides to rectify a few wrongs.”

Eden and Hagman hadn’t worked together since they did the TV movie “A Howling in the Woods” 15 years ago.
